Heroku VS Firebase

Heroku

Heroku is a cloud platform as a service (PaaS) that enables developers to build, run, and scale applications in a variety of languages. With Heroku, you can deploy your application by pushing your code to a Git repository, and the platform will automatically build and run your application.

Heroku provides a number of services and features that are designed to help you build and manage your applications, including support for a variety of programming languages, a cloud-based application server, a managed database service, and a number of other tools and services. You can use Heroku to deploy a wide range of applications, including web applications, mobile applications, and APIs.

Firebase

Firebase is a mobile and web application development platform developed by Google. It offers a number of services for developing and managing mobile and web applications, including a real-time database, user authentication, hosting, and analytics. Firebase provides developers with a number of tools and APIs for building and managing applications, including a cloud-based NoSQL database, user authentication, and hosting.

You can use Firebase to build and deploy a variety of different types of applications, including mobile apps, web apps, and real-time collaboration apps.

  • Heroku
    • host web applications written in a variety of languages, including as Java, Ruby, Python, and Java
    • enables the use of custom domains
    • offers both a free plan and premium options with more features and scalability
    • enables for scalable and on-demand resource provisioning and integrates with a variety of add-ons
    • Suitable for web programmes written in a variety of languages, with the capacity to expand and make resources available as needed
    • has numerous deploy choices, a pipeline creation capability, and a build and deployment function
  • Firebase
    • Global CDN-based hosting
    • Firebase Authentication is integrated support for authentication and authorisation
    • Firebase CLI and Firebase Hosting are used for deployment and hosting respectively, with built-in support for continuous integration and deployment
    • features a free tier and fees for more usage and storage
    • connects to more Firebase products, including Firestore, Cloud Functions, and Hosting
    • More suitable for online and mobile applications that need authentication and authorization features, as well as applications that require hosting or real-time databases
